O R Baker Elementary School serves 303 students in grades Prekindergarten-2.
The student-teacher ratio of 13:1 is lower than the Indiana state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ment is 17%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Indiana state average of 38% (majority Hispanic).

O R Baker Elementary School's student population of 303 students has grown by 6% over five school years.
The teacher population of 24 teachers has grown by 20% over five school years.
